绘制具有两列索引的数据框并显示x-tick值

时间:2019-02-19 13:50:58

标签: python pandas matplotlib

假设我有一个数据框,它的索引由两列组成,我想绘制它:

import pandas
from matplotlib import pyplot as plot
df=pandas.DataFrame(data={'floor':[1,1,1,2,2,2,3,3],'room':[1,2,3,1,1,2,1,3],'count':[1, 1, 3,2,2,4,1,5]})
df2=df.groupby(['floor','room']).sum()
df2.plot()
plot.show()

上面的示例将生成一个绘图,其中行号用于x轴,并且没有刻度标签。 是否有使用索引的设施?

说,我想将x轴分成索引第一列的偶数部分,并在这些部分内散布第二索引列的点值。

0 个答案:

没有答案